The governor of Kharkiv Oblast (Ukrainian: Голова Харківської обласної державної адміністрації) is the head of the executive branch for the Kharkiv Oblast.
The office of governor is an appointed position, with officeholders being appointed by the president of Ukraine, on recommendation from the Prime Minister of Ukraine, to serve a four-year term.
On 24 December 2021 Oleh Synyehubov was appointed governor of Kharkiv Oblast.
[1] The official residence for the governor is located in Kharkiv.
